SYMPTOMS

When you run the Workgroup Mail application included in Windows for Workgroups 3.1 for the first time, you may receive the following message

The postoffice is already being managed by <XXX>. Try again later.

where <XXX> is the name of the actual Workgroup Postoffice administrator.

WORKAROUND

Close the Postoffice Manager and then try again.

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ed this to be a problem in the Workgroup Mail application included with Windows for Workgroups version 3.1.

MORE INFORMATION

Steps to Reproduce Problem

  1. Open the Postoffice Manager.
  2. Select a user and choose Details.
  3. Go to another machine that has not started Workgroup Mail and start it the application.
  4. When asked whether to connect to an existing postoffice or to create a new Workgroup Postoffice, choose to connect to an existing postoffice.
  5. Select the correct postoffice and choose OK.
  6. When asked if you have an account on the postoffice, choose No.
  7. Enter your account details and choose OK.
